IMPORTANT INFORMATION: If you are currently using another Fax-Program, you will have to disable or remove it before using FaxMail for Windows as two Fax-Programs can not share the same Fax/Modem or run concurrently. To disable it may be as easy as not loading it or you may have to remove one or more lines from your AUTOEXEC.BAT, CONFIG.SYS, WIN.INI or SYSTEM.INI. Typing rem ahead of a line in your AUTOEXEC.BAT or CONFIG.SYS will disable it. Example: change: C:\OLD_FAX_DIR\OLFAXPRG.EXE to: rem C:\OLD_FAX_DIR\OLFAXPRG.EXE To disable a line in an .INI (WIN.INI and SYSTEM.INI) place a ; before the line to be commented. Example: change: C:\OLD_FAX_DIR\OLD_FAX_PRG.EXE to: ;C:\OLD_FAX_DIR\OLD_FAX_PRG.EXE The only exception is; if you are using an Intel SatisFAXtion CAS Fax/Modem, you will not want to remove the CAS manager. ALL other (Class 1 and Class 2) Fax/Modems will use the Fax/Modem-Drivers provided by FaxMail for Windows. If your old Fax-Program loads from the Windows-StartUp-Group as you enter Windows, you will have to move it's ICON out of your Windows-StartUp-Group by grabbing it and dropping it in another Group. But...Before these addresses can be used, your "COM-Port/Fax/Modem" must first support the configuration and second you must properly configure said device. Never skip a COM-Port as the system will go into "conflict-convulsion" from time to time. To find a vacant IRQ, run something like SYSONFO.EXE, etc. Here is information on 9 IRQs in the IBM-Compatible. They are: IRQ0 - IRQ7. N/A means not normally available for your Fax/Modem. IRQ0 {INT 08h, Reserved for 8253 Channel 0 System-Timer-Tick, N/A IRQ1 {INT 09h, Reserved for Key-Board Attention, N/A IRQ2 {INT 0Ah, Reserved for Future use, (you can use if not in use) IRQ3 {INT 0Bh, Reserved for COM2-IRQ3, or COM4-IRQ3 *If not used by COM2 IRQ4 {INT 0Ch, Reserved for COM1-IRQ4, or COM3-IRQ4 *If not used by COM1 IRQ5 {INT 0Dh, Reserved for XT-HardDrive, Can used unless you have an XT :) IRQ6 {INT 0Eh, Reserved for Disk Attention, N/A IRQ7 {INT 0Fh, LPT1, but usually doesn't need IRQ, usually can be used IRQ8 - IRQ15 {information N/A The following report was generated by Peter Norton's SYSINFO.EXE on a 486DX-50: *************************** * Hardware Interrupts * *************************** Number Address Name Owner IRQ 00 FCAC:0043 Timer Output 0 BIOS IRQ 01 FCAC:0048 Keyboard BIOS IRQ 02 08AB:0057 [Cascade] DOS System Area IRQ 03 08AB:006F COM2 DOS System Area IRQ 04 0A4D:9F5A COM1 FM_ROCK2.COM IRQ 05 08AB:009F LPT2 DOS System Area IRQ 06 08AB:00B7 Floppy Disk DOS System Area IRQ 07 0070:06F4 LPT1 DOS System Area IRQ 08 0000:0000 Realtime Clock Unused IRQ 09 0000:0000 Reserved Unused IRQ 10 0000:0000 Reserved Unused IRQ 11 0000:0000 Reserved Unused IRQ 12 0000:0000 Reserved Unused IRQ 13 0000:0000 Coprocessor Unused IRQ 14 0000:0000 Fixed Disk Unused IRQ 15 0000:0000 Reserved Unused Note 1: As you can see, if IRQ4 is used by COM1, you have to find another IRQ for COM3. If you have a COM1-IRQ4 and you use COM3 you will need to use one of the alternative IRQ. The same goes if you are going to use COM4 and you have a COM2-IRQ3. Note 2: It is best to use COM1-IRQ4 or COM2-IRQ3 for Fax/Modems, as they were originally and specifically set aside for communications. Experience has shown me that some Fax/Modems do not preform as well on COM3 and COM4 using IRQ2, IRQ7 or IRQ5. BEFORE SOFTWARE INSTALLATION: If, while installing FaxMail for Windows you find that your Fax/Modem is not listed, it is possible that one of the selections will work. For instance, DoveFax Class 1 and Practical Peripherals Class 1 works with many other class 1 Fax/Modems. The {"Universal, Rockwell, Class 2"} will work with nearly all of the Fax/Modems derived from the "Rockwell Class 2 Accelerator Kit". Generic Class 2, Zoom Class 2, ZyXEL Class 2, and Dallas Class 2 Fax/Modem-Drivers are all Class 2 Fax/Modem-Drivers. There are a lot of "Class 2" variations, so, if your "Class 2" board does not work with one, it may work with another. The "Universal, Hayes, Rockwell, Class 1", "Universal, Rockwell, Class 1", and the "Universal, Rockwell, Class 2" Fax/Modem-Drivers are designed to do the job if all else fails. It should not always be the first choice because even though it is more versatile, it may not perform as well as the one recommended by us. Depending on your computer, another Fax/Modem-Driver may work better than our recommended one though. Sometimes, depending on your computer, COM-Port (FIFO(16550) or not), the "Universal, Hayes, Rockwell, Class 1", "Universal, Rockwell, Class 1", - or - "Universal, Rockwell, Class 2" may outperform the recommended Fax/Modem-Driver. By The Way, these 2 Fax/Modem-Drivers support FIFO operation. If your Fax/Modem is not listed, look for an alternate Fax/Modem-Driver. An Internal Fax/Modem-Driver can be used to drive an External Fax/Modem, and an External Fax/Modem-Driver can be used to drive an Internal Fax/Modem. The name is not important. For instance, the AT&T class 1 will work on many other class 1 Fax/Modems. Choosing the wrong Fax/Modem-Driver will not harm Anything. HELPFUL HINTS: "Silent Answer" Silent Answer requires the support and cooperation of the remote sending Fax/Modem/Machine with your receiving Fax/Modem. If the sending Fax/Modem/Machine does not support "Silent Answer" by sending the "CNG" tone, you will lose that Fax! Please read *all* of this area before using "Silent Answer". If you still want "Silent Answer", here is what it does and how to implement it. Silent answer let one telephone line be used for two purposes; receiving FAXes with the Fax/Modem, and receiving voice calls with an answering machine or telephone. When set to this mode, the Fax/Modem lets your answering machine answer all incoming calls. If it detects Fax "CNG" tones, it routes the call to FaxMail for Windows. Otherwise, it just sits silently on the phone line while you or your answering machine takes the call. When the phone rings and after the second ring the Fax/Modem will start monitoring the telephone line. If it detects a Fax tone, it will receive the Fax. If it does not detects a fax tone, it will do nothing. Silent Answer hardware installation When installing the Fax/Modem, DO NOT plug the answering machine into the telephone jack on the back of the Fax/Modem. Instead, do one of the following: a. Plug the answering machine and Fax/Modem into different wall jack (i.e. jacks in different rooms). b. Plug the answering machine into a wall jack and the Fax/Modem into the answering machine. c. If your answering machine has some kind of phone-jack switching; use this method. You must locate the two devices on separate extensions to make silent answer work correctly. This means you can not plug the answering machine into the Fax/Modem or vise versa. You can split a single extension with a duplex jack adapter. Radio Shack commonly carries these, part number 279-357 for $4.49. Also, if you have an older answering machine that does NOT automatically turn itself off when it detects that a person or the Fax/Modem has answered the call, you need a $7.95 adapter from Radio Shack, part#43-107. This adapter disconnects the answering machine from the phone line when the call is answered. It goes between the answering machine and the wall jack. Note: The device that is picking up the line initially, must answer after, and not before, the second ring. This means you should set it to 3 for best results. If no other device picks up the line by the time the number of rings that FaxMail for Windows is set to is reached, FaxMail for Windows will answer it and process a Fax. To activate Silent Answer Load the FaxMail for Windows 'Control' program and click on the Button, Button and on the Silent Answer Button. Set the number of rings until we answer to four and set your answering-machine to three rings. If the Silent Answer Button is inactive and gray, your Fax/Modem does not support Silent Answer. How to enable auto-load When you boot-up, you have a choice as to weather you want to load the FaxMail for Windows Fax/Modem-Driver or not. If you plan to always load the FaxMail for Windows Fax/Modem-Driver, you can place y or Y behind the Fax/Modem-Driver. Here are two examples: examples #1 (First line in your AUTOEXEC.BAT) LH C:\FAXMAIL\FM_ROCK2.COM will ask: Do you want to load the "FaxMail for Windows" Fax/Modem-Driver? (Y/N) Y examples #2 (First line in your AUTOEXEC.BAT) LH C:\FAXMAIL\FM_ROCK2.COM Y The Y parameter will cause the Fax/Modem-Driver to load without asking. It will always load without stopping or asking. If you want to use the same computer for Fax and data-modem(BBS), it may be necessary to Disable the FaxMail for Windows Fax/Modem-Driver while calling a BBS. To Disable FaxMail for Windows Fax/Modem-Driver run: BBS-MODE.COM. Use FAX-MODE.COM to Enable the Fax/Modem-Driver again after you log-off the BBS. Here is an example of a Batch(.BAT) File that will do it all for you. Lets say that you are using a BBS program called Telemate, and it's name is TM.EXE. The following Batch File will Disable the "Fax/Modem-Driver" load "Telemate" and when you exit the BBS program (Telemate) it will "Enable" the Fax/Modem-Driver so you can resume FAXing. At the DOS Prompt: COPY CON T.BAT {Create file(T.BAT) C:\FaxMail\BBS-MODE.COM {1st line in file(T.BAT) PAUSE {2nd line in file(T.BAT) CD\TELEMATE {3rd line in file(T.BAT) TM.EXE {4th line in file(T.BAT) C:\FaxMail\FAX-MODE.COM {5th, and Save(T.BAT) - or - Using a text editor, create a file called T.BAT with the following 3 lines: C:\FaxMail\BBS-MODE.COM {Set Fax/Modem to Data-Mode(BBS) PAUSE {Pause to let Fax/Modem catch up(4 seconds or more) CD\TELEMATE {Change Directory to BBS Software TM.EXE {Load BBS Software C:\FaxMail\FAX-MODE.COM {Set Fax/Modem to Fax-Mode(FaxMail) The above example assumes that your FaxMail Directory is FAXMAIL and your Telemate Directory is TELEMATE. Now when you want to call a BBS you type: T Method - 4 - To remove FaxMail for Windows Fax/Modem-Driver, type "rem " in front of these two lines, in your AUTOEXEC.BAT: rem LH C:\FAXMAIL\FM_ROCK2.COM rem LH C:\FAXMAIL\FM_DS_IN.COM ....and RE-BOOT. To restore back to "FaxMail for Windows", reactivate the two lines, in your AUTOEXEC.BAT: LH C:\FAXMAIL\FM_ROCK2.COM LH C:\FAXMAIL\FM_DS_IN.COM ....and RE-BOOT. NOTE: If your Fax/Modem is a CAS (or CAS compatible) board, such as the Intel SatisFAXtion, you might not have to remove the Fax/Modem-Driver for data-modem(BBS) use. If you hear the modem give a short beep tone after dialing but before the line has been answered, your modem will probably not operate properly for data communications with the Fax/Modem-Driver installed. In some cases, to reset your modem to data mode, you may have to manually reset the modem (if it's external) or turn the PC off and then back on (for internal modems that don't reset any other way).
